Как я могу открыть проект, не открывая связанное с ним решение в Visual Studio? - PullRequest
18 голосов
/ 13 января 2011

У меня есть решение, которое содержит несколько проектов. Проблема в том, что когда я хочу открыть только один из проектов, щелкнув по конкретному файлу .csproj, он открывает все решение.

Как открыть только один проект?

Спасибо.

Ответы [ 5 ]

28 голосов
/ 13 января 2011

Вы можете создать новое решение и добавить этот проект в решение.Тогда у этого проекта будет собственное решение.

7 голосов
/ 13 января 2011

Это взлом, но временно переименуйте файл .sln в другое расширение, затем дважды щелкните по csprojВ Visual Studio, похоже, есть интеллектуальные знаки для определения решений.

1 голос
/ 05 апреля 2016

Единственный способ сделать это - удалить проект из основного решения, сохранить его и закрыть.

Теперь вы сможете открыть решение и файл проекта независимо друг от друга.

Примечание: открытие файла csproj создаст для вас новое решение.

0 голосов
/ 26 января 2019

Почему я хочу открыть один проект из решения? У меня есть решение с 66 подпроектами, поэтому полезно, если вы можете редактировать только один проект. Я уже перепробовал много возможностей, как описано выше. Сегодня я в основном делаю это с помощью команды «Scope to this» в проводнике проекта. Поэтому я сосредоточен только на одном проекте. Надеюсь, этот совет был вам полезен :-)

0 голосов
/ 13 января 2011

Вы не можете.Базовая единица Visual Studio - это решение.

...